World of Goo is a 2D physics-based puzzle game where the goal of the game is to build structures from balls of goo, all strung together, in order to solve puzzles. Each level has unique problems to solve as well as new visual and music themes.

Pros
Pro Unique and beautiful visual style that stands all on its own
World of Goo is pleasing to look at. Most of the time it's very colorful and joyful, but it changes from time to time to reflect different parts of the world. Nevertheless, it is stylistically well presented throughout the game.
Pro Entertaining story thanks to a twisted tale with some philosophical messages sprinkled in
As you start playing, there doesn't seem to be much of a story. A few philosophical messages left behind by the Sign Painter and a cut-scene here or there. But as you progress through the game, you unearth different details about a slightly disturbing world.
Pro The core of the gameplay uses an excellent physics engine, which gives a pretty realistic feeling when interacting with the structures
Physics in-game take into account gravity, wind, weight of different goo-balls, structural integrity of your architectural solutions to create an addictive, "let me try this one more time"-type of gameplay.

Con Sound can't be turned off in-game
World of Goo sadly does not have an option to turn off in game music. This would be ideal for those that would like to listen to their own music while still retaining the sound effects of the game.
